Abu Dhabi Airports Free Zone (ADAFZ) is operated by Abu Dhabi Airports, the operator of the emirate's airports. It spans more than 12 km² adjacent to Zayed International Airport, with a presence across Al Ain International and Al Bateen Executive airports, giving businesses direct proximity to air cargo, passenger traffic and aviation infrastructure.

Its focus follows its location. ADAFZ was built to serve aviation, aerospace, aircraft interiors and airport services, alongside logistics, e-commerce and ICT businesses that depend on air connectivity. It offers world-class warehousing units and aircraft hangars, making it a natural base for MRO (maintenance, repair and overhaul), air cargo, freight forwarding and time-sensitive trade. For any business whose model runs through an airport, ADAFZ pairs that airside adjacency with 100% foreign ownership and the standard free-zone framework.

Legal Structures Under Abu Dhabi Airports Free Zone

ADAFZ recognises the standard free-zone legal forms.

01

Free Zone LLC (Single Shareholder)

A limited-liability entity with one shareholder, individual or corporate — common for owner-run businesses.

02

Free Zone LLC (Multiple Shareholders)

A limited-liability entity with two or more shareholders, for partnerships and joint ventures.

03

Branch of an Existing Company

A branch of an existing UAE or foreign aviation or logistics company operating under the parent's identity.

Tax & Compliance Position — Abu Dhabi Airports Free Zone

ADAFZ entities follow UAE Federal Corporate Tax and can qualify for the 0% QFZP rate. As an air-cargo and logistics zone, the VAT and customs position around goods matters.

UAE Corporate Tax

9% Headline · 0% QFZP on Qualifying Income

ADAFZ entities follow UAE Federal Corporate Tax under Decree-Law 47/2022 — 9% on taxable income above AED 375,000. Most can elect the Qualifying Free Zone Person (QFZP) regime and pay 0% on Qualifying Income.

QFZP eligibilityQualifying activities include logistics, MRO and qualifying trading; sales into the UAE mainland are treated differently. Eligibility needs adequate Free Zone substance, arm's-length transfer pricing and audited financials.
UAE VAT

5% Standard Rate · Air-Cargo Treatments Apply

ADAFZ entities follow UAE VAT — 5% on taxable supplies, AED 375,000 mandatory registration threshold. Exports and certain international transport and aviation services can be zero-rated, while domestic supplies are standard-rated.

Designated Zone status: verify with FTADesignated-Zone status for goods is set by Cabinet decision and can change; for an air-cargo or logistics operation the treatment turns on the flow. We confirm the current status and map the VAT treatment to your specific operation.

Does an ADAFZ company qualify for the 0% Corporate Tax rate?
ADAFZ is a UAE free zone for Corporate Tax. The 0% rate applies to qualifying income earned by a Qualifying Free Zone Person — which can include logistics, MRO and qualifying trading — while mainland sales are treated differently and non-qualifying income is taxed at 9%. We assess the position against your activity.
How is air cargo treated for VAT?
Exports and certain international transport and aviation services can be zero-rated under UAE VAT, while domestic supplies are standard-rated at 5%. Because the treatment depends on the flow, we map the VAT position to your specific cargo or aviation operation rather than assuming a single rate.
